Hawthorne - Brook Farm and Concord Part II

from The Henry James Library · host Henry James

In which the author recounts a solitary yet contented sojourn at the Manse in Concord, marked by reflective companionship with nature, literary pursuits, and a delightful camaraderie with local intellects such as Thoreau and Channing. Here, amid the quiet New England village steeped in history and homely detail, Hawthorne’s sombre fancy flourishes even during his happiest days, revealing a complex interplay between his inner darkness and outward tranquillity.
